Java 是一种可以撰写跨平台应用软件的面向对象的程序设计语言 Java 技术具有卓越的通用性高效性平台移植性和安全性, 广泛应用于 PC 数据中心游戏控制台科学超级计算机移动电话和互联网, 同时拥有全球最大的开发者专业社群
给你 java 学习路线: html-CSS-js-jq-javase - 数据库 - jsp-servlet-Struts2-hibernate-mybatis-spring4-springmvc-ssh-ssm
2.7.1 项目分类
在公司做的项目可以分为两种 产品项目
项目: 就是给一些公司接的项目, 项目开发完成后, 就交互, 后面这个项目代码就不再维护了
产品: 充分考虑扩展性和基本义务, 来做一个产品, 在这个产品上可以进行定制开发
小编推荐一个学 Java 的学习裙 六五零, 五五四, 六零七 , 无论你是大牛还是小白, 是想转行还是想入行都可以来了解一起进步一起学习! 裙内有开发工具, 很多干货和技术资料分享!
2.7.2 项目参与者
产品经理架构师 (SE) 开发测试 UI 资料 PMMDE
开发团队: 开始代码能完成需求
测试团队: 测试功能
UI: 负责界面设计静态代码的编写
资料: 负责界面的文字描述
QA: 通过项目质量监控, 和 PM,SE 同级别
开发和 UI 和资料, 协同设计和开发, 开发完成后转测试策略交给测试团队进行测试, 测试完成后会出一个测试报告
小编推荐一个学 Java 的学习裙 六五零, 五五四, 六零七 , 无论你是大牛还是小白, 是想转行还是想入行都可以来了解一起进步一起学习! 裙内有开发工具, 很多干货和技术资料分享!
2.7.3 项目流程
可行性分析和立项和开会
需求分析
需求设计
项目开发(多个迭代)
迭代开工会
迭代设计
迭代开发
迭代测试
集成测试
迭代发布
迭代总结
.... 不断迭代
项目验收
项目总结
小编推荐一个学 Java 的学习裙 六五零, 五五四, 六零七 , 无论你是大牛还是小白, 是想转行还是想入行都可以来了解一起进步一起学习! 裙内有开发工具, 很多干货和技术资料分享!
2.7.4 业务注意事项
1 不要在多个项目都说你同一个模块如果要说, 就说后面是进行改进
2 多写点业务
来源: http://www.jianshu.com/p/9eb9758cf9a2